Timber Home Window Frames



Timber window frames bring a timeless beauty to any kind of home, combining elegance with functionality. They use excellent insulation, keeping your room relaxing in wintertime and cool in summer.

You'll appreciate the natural aesthetics, as timber adds warmth and personality that complements numerous architectural styles. Nonetheless, they do call for normal upkeep to avoid rot, warping, or insect damages.



You'll need to paint or discolor them periodically to keep their appearance and longevity. While wood frames can be a lot more costly upfront, their durability often makes them a worthwhile financial investment.

Plastic Window Frames



If you're seeking a low-maintenance option to wood, plastic home window structures may be the excellent option. They're very durable and resistant to fading, peeling, and cracking, which implies you will not have to bother with continuous upkeep.

Installation is generally simple, conserving you time and money. Plus, plastic frameworks come in different shades and styles, allowing you to match your home's visual conveniently.

On the downside, plastic might not supply the exact same classic look as wood, and it can not be painted if you want a color modification. In addition, severe temperatures can impact the frame's stability in time.

Nevertheless, if you prioritize resilience and marginal upkeep, plastic window structures can be an outstanding choice for your home.

Aluminum and Fiberglass Home Window Frames



When considering window structure products, light weight aluminum and fiberglass stand apart as two durable alternatives.

Light weight aluminum frames are known for their strength and toughness. They stand up to bending and can handle severe weather, making them a trustworthy option. Plus, they use a smooth, contemporary appearance that enhances numerous building designs. Nevertheless, they can carry out heat and cold, which may affect power efficiency.

On the other hand, fiberglass structures offer excellent insulation and are highly energy-efficient. They're resistant to wetness and won't warp or swell with time.

While they have a tendency to be more pricey ahead of time, their long life can conserve you cash in the future. Ultimately, your option will depend upon your spending plan, visual preference, and power effectiveness demands.
